That is the place MZed Professional for Christmas turns out to be useful. (No matter whether or not you present it to somebody particular, or to your self.) Our instructional platform is filled with programs that sort out the subject of intentional filmmaking. But what precisely does this imply?

In easy phrases, it’s when every little thing in your movie serves the story and imaginative and prescient. As an illustration, within the course “Cinematography for Administrators,” filmmaker and educator Tal Lazar talks about “efficient photographs.” The concept behind it’s that the pictures we select for our scenes won’t be conventionally stunning or generally likable, however they should have a objective. Largely, these push the story ahead, convey emotion, or give us some essential details about the characters. As an illustration, check out this well-known nonetheless from the basic, “The Godfather.

A movie nonetheless from “The Godfather” by Francis Ford Coppola, 1972

Faces are darkish, eyes are barely seen, and the characters are nearly mixing into the background. Not essentially the most “fulfilling” picture, is it? But it tells us a lot!

Intentional filmmaking will also be seen in lighting decisions. When viewers can perceive the context just by taking a look at a picture, it is actually because the lighting is doing its job. These photographs from “No Nation for Previous Males” might properly have been filmed totally in a studio. But once we have a look at them, we instantly learn a sequence of particulars via the lighting alone. It’s evening. The character is in a lodge room, not on the bottom flooring. Somebody is approaching from outdoors, instructed by the spill of a fluorescent mild seeping via the crack beneath the door. We perceive all of this as a result of we’re aware of how mild behaves in actual life, and cautious emulation of these cues helps the story unfold with out rationalization.

Intentional modifying not solely units up the rhythm for the movie but in addition navigates the viewers’s consideration and creates the character’s arc. From the course “The Artwork and Strategy of Movie Modifying,” held by Oscar-winning editor Tom Cross, I discovered the reply to a significant query: “How do I lower in a manner that I get into this character’s head?” It actually helps to re-read the script, set up whose scene it’s, and whose viewpoint you have to convey, earlier than going via the footage. As an illustration, the “Whiplash” desk scene beneath is all concerning the protagonist, Andrew, and the shift in his angle after feeling unappreciated by his household. The modifying leans closely on response photographs, permitting his feelings to come back via with no need specific dialogue.:
